using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using QMFrameWork.Data.Attributes;
using QMAPP.Entity;
using System.Data;
namespace QMAPP.FJC.Entity.Basic
{
///
/// 模块编号:M2-8
/// 作 用:加工参数标准值设定数据模型
/// 作 者:王丹丹
/// 编写日期:2015年06月03日
///
[DBTable(TableName = "T_BD_PROCESSPARAMETER", TimeStampColumn = "UPDATEDATE")]
public class ProcessParameter : BaseEntity
{
#region 数据库字段
///
///加工参数主键
///
[DBColumn(ColumnName = "PID", DataType = DbType.String, IsKey = true)]
public string PID { get; set; }
///
///间隔设置
///
[DBColumn(ColumnName = "STEP", DataType = DbType.Decimal)]
public decimal STEP { get; set; }
///
///参数名称
///
[DBColumn(ColumnName = "PARADESCRIBE", DataType = DbType.String)]
public string PARADESCRIBE { get; set; }
///
///参数名称
///
[DBColumn(ColumnName = "PARANAME", DataType = DbType.String)]
public string PARANAME { get; set; }
///
///加工参数表名称
///
[DBColumn(ColumnName = "PARATABLENAME", DataType = DbType.String)]
public string PARATABLENAME { get; set; }
///
///设备信息主键
///
[DBColumn(ColumnName = "MACHINEID", DataType = DbType.String)]
public string MACHINEID { get; set; }
///
///设备编码
///
[DBColumn(ColumnName = "MACHINECODDE", DataType = DbType.String)]
public string MACHINECODDE { get; set; }
///
///工序编码
///
[DBColumn(ColumnName = "WORKCELL_CODE", DataType = DbType.String)]
public string WORKCELL_CODE { get; set; }
///
///工序类别 (6:冷刀弱化 7:火焰加工 8:预热 9:浇注 10:红外扫描 11:冲切 12:铣削 13:铆接 14:超时波焊接 15:红外焊接 16:总成装配
///
[DBColumn(ColumnName = "PROCESSTYPE", DataType = DbType.String)]
public string PROCESSTYPE { get; set; }
public string PROCESSTYPESEARCH { get; set; }
public string PROCESSTYPETXT { get; set; }
///
///生产线
///
[DBColumn(ColumnName = "PRODUCELINE", DataType = DbType.String)]
public string PRODUCELINE { get; set; }
///
///上限值
///
[DBColumn(ColumnName = "MAXVALUE", DataType = DbType.Decimal)]
public decimal MAXVALUE { get; set; }
///
///下限值
///
[DBColumn(ColumnName = "MINVALUE", DataType = DbType.Decimal)]
public decimal MINVALUE { get; set; }
///
///备注--作为显示视图名称和导出模板名称
///
[DBColumn(ColumnName = "MEMO", DataType = DbType.String)]
public string MEMO { get; set; }
///
///创建用户
///
[DBColumn(ColumnName = "CREATEUSER", DataType = DbType.String)]
public string CREATEUSER { get; set; }
public string CREATEUSERNAME { get; set; }
///
///创建时间
///
[DBColumn(ColumnName = "CREATEDATE", DataType = DbType.DateTime)]
public DateTime CREATEDATE { get; set; }
///
///更新用户
///
[DBColumn(ColumnName = "UPDATEUSER", DataType = DbType.String)]
public string UPDATEUSER { get; set; }
public string UPDATEUSERNAME { get; set; }
///
///更新时间
///
[DBColumn(ColumnName = "UPDATEDATE", DataType = DbType.DateTime)]
public DateTime UPDATEDATE { get; set; }
///
/// 对其方式
///
[DBColumn(ColumnName = "ALIGNVALUE", DataType = DbType.String)]
public string ALIGNVALUE { get; set; }
///
/// 定义列宽
///
[DBColumn(ColumnName = "WIDTH", DataType = DbType.Int32)]
public int WIDTH { get; set; }
///
/// 定义列宽
///
[DBColumn(ColumnName = "SHOWINDEX", DataType = DbType.Int32)]
public int SHOWINDEX { get; set; }
#endregion
#region 扩展字段
///
/// 选择列
///
public string SelectColumn { get; set; }
///
/// 监控数量
///
public int MonitorCount { get; set; }
///
/// 监控起始值
///
public double MVStart { get; set; }
///
/// 监控结束值
///
public double MVEnd { get; set; }
///
/// 工序类别(注塑,用于设备加工记录查询)
///
public string PROCESSTYPES { get; set; }
///
/// 数据类型
///
public string FormatDate { get; set; }
///
/// 设备
///
public string MachineCode { get; set; }
///
/// 模架
///
public string MouldCode { get; set; }
///
/// 零件条码
///
public string ProductCode { get; set; }
///
/// 加工日期开始
///
public string CREATEDATESTART { get; set; }
///
/// 加工日期结束
///
public string CREATEDATEEND { get; set; }
///
/// 参数字段列表
///
public string Fileds { get; set; }
#endregion
}
}